**Runbook §4.2 — Account recovery, Echoway audio-guide app.** For the weekly sync: when a curator account on Echoway is locked, verify identity against the Marlowe Hall staff roster, then trigger reset from the admin panel. If the admin panel itself is unreachable, fall back to the bootstrap account — it bypasses SSO and should be used sparingly. Log every use in the sync notes. The bootstrap recovery passphrase is below.

unlock words, kawef-yafog: sordor-eliix

Welcome to the LiftLogic simulator team. The dispatch simulator replays elevator traffic patterns against candidate scheduling algorithms, and all simulation runs are submitted through the internal Shaftline orchestration service. Access is scoped read-and-submit only; no production building data is ever touched. For your review environment, authenticate your first test submission with the service key provided below.

gateway credential: zpat15_lMLOSdhT94y0U3l

TICKET-4482: Expired credentials in mdpipe renderer

The Slateform markdown rendering pipeline stopped publishing at 03:10. Root cause: the token used by the `mdpipe-worker` to call the Glyphbound asset service expired; rotation job was disabled during the Pellworth migration and never re-enabled. Fix: re-enable `rotate-mdpipe` in the scheduler, redeploy workers, confirm previews render. Until rotation is automated again, maintainers must update the worker config by hand. The current replacement key is as follows.

app token of baduf-yawif = qvz11-yXcoVKWLtwX

Handover note — Crumbwheel order cutoffs.

Welcome aboard. The bakery cutoff rule in Crumbwheel closes same-day orders at 14:00 local to each storefront, not UTC — this has bitten us twice. Holiday overrides live in the calendar service and take precedence silently, so always check there first when a cutoff looks wrong. To unlock the calendar service's admin console after a restart, enter the recovery passphrase below.

vault phrase of bagap-bahaf = silion-pelox-sorox-casdor-quenwyn-fraax-eliox-praael-kelion-quenvan-kasox-rusael-norius-belvan